My mom has only been her a very short time, so my rating may not be totally fair. Cleanliness of the whole floor is good, but mom's unit smells like urine, and I had to ask to get her very dirty floor vacuumed. I don't feel I should have to ask this. Also, I oftentimes find clean( i hope) clothes laying around. Almost Everyone appears very friendly, but one aide was sorely lacking in approach and initiative... Maybe just a miserable person, in general? The Nurse is wonderful, and I think most of the aides seem genuine... But it's only been a short time. But so far, they appear "real". Value is ok, but ill reserve my true judgement on that for a bit later because care services are somewhat lacking in some areas. I've had to ask numerous times and leave notes as well, for a few things on mom's rx plan that were not being adhered to. This gets frustrating and one thing is/was quite impt. There are a few other care concerns that I have had to address, and hopefully, they will be attended to. Oh, and food is complained about by almost everyone. I'm not sure if it really is bad most of the time, or if it's just the residents' perceptions!! My mom seems to really enjoy all of the activities she decides to engage in. She loves the activity people, and they seem to try to get the residents involved. I guess they can only offer activities and urge people to partake of them. Overall I gave the facility a 3.5. But this is only based on a short time frame, so I'm not sure if it is accurate. It's the best I can do with what we have experienced up to this point. I think I need to give it more time before an accurate gauge of measurement is given.

Beautiful facility; the Alzheimer's Unit (Ruth's Garden) has very good activities and staff interaction. The nursing group is top rate. The food is delicious, although as in most places, some days are better than others. Good healthy choices are available to residents. The reason there are fewer than five stars is the experience of having a relative briefly in the Garden Unit and with assistance needed after a hospital staff, we had to add outside aides to help. This led to recommendations to have this relative placed in the Long Term Care unit. Once there, the resident was in the Alzheimer's LTC unit and sat all day at a table in the dining area with people moaning and screaming around her. Was unable to get her out of that unit and into the lovely LTC there. She is now in a beautiful ALF (!), has activities, the facility ALWAYS smells clean and fresh. It was the transitional "push" that became problematic and made me wonder if the Garden is just the entree to LTC.
